Grayish Blue

The color #676C77 is a grayish blue that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 103, 108, 119 and HSL values of 221°, 7%, 44%.

Complementary Colors for #676C77

The complementary color for #676C77 is #787368.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#676C77

The analogous colors for #676C77 are #687578 and #6B6878.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#676C77

The triadic colors for #676C77 are #78686D and #6D7868.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.
